About Us 

The City of London Corporation manages 11,000 acres of land in and around London that is enjoyed by over 16 million visitors annually. Whilst there are small pockets of land within the Square Mile, the majority can be found elsewhere in London and the surrounding counties.The City Corporation acts as Trustee of 10 charities which, through their variouscharitableobjects,are responsible forthe preservation in perpetuity ofa large proportionof these award-winning open spaces.
